Acteon Greek Hunter by Adrien Etienne Gaudez French Bronze Statue Sculpture 46"

About the Item

A remarkable French Bronze sculpture of Acteon by Adrein Etienne Gaudez. The statue is sculpted in lifelike detail, featuring Acteon with a bird in his outstretched arm, standing on one leg with a French horn in his other arm. Includes a neat Cartouche label surrounded by a bat and horn. The bronze is signed along the top of the base and rests on a marble plinth. In Greek mythology, Actaeon is a hunter and hero from Thebes who is transformed into a deer and killed by his hounds after seeing Artemis bathing. Actaeon is the son of Aristaeus, a minor god and herdsman, and Autonoe, daughter of Cadmus, the founder of Thebes. Actaeon is also a member of the ruling House of Cadmus through his mother. Dimensions: 13" x 13" x 46"h
